Output 05a26f20ff6a8b0e537091a25d288b84069810986f82a4c46b2102484080cc23:1

value
107897926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e8c0654e36c8a6af33f3d8bff67915047401cf OP_EQUAL
address
MRfk9WK81EM78XfF67XkYhSjqB3TFJxvHX
transaction
05a26f20ff6a8b0e537091a25d288b84069810986f82a4c46b2102484080cc23
spent
true